Jupiter-like planet 8 UMi b, named Halla, orbits its host red giant star Baekdu closely (only 0.46 astronomical units away). The red giant's merger with a white dwarf star questions how Halla could exist. Full Story: https://www.space.com/forbidden-planet-escapes-dying-star
